The Common University Entrance Test (CUET) UG 2025 offers a wide range of subjects for students aspiring to get admission to Jawaharlal Nehru University (JNU) and other participating universities. As per the CUET UG 2025 Information Bulletin, the National Testing Agency (NTA) provides 37 subjects, which include 13 languages, 23 domain subjects, and a General Aptitude Test. Below is a detailed list of all the subjects:
1. Languages (13 Languages):
English
Hindi
Assamese
Bengali
Gujarati
Kannada
Malayalam
Marathi
Odia
Punjabi
Tamil
Telugu
Urdu
2. Domain Subjects (23 Subjects):
Accountancy/Book Keeping
Agriculture
Anthropology
Biology/Biological Studies/Biotechnology/Biochemistry
Business Studies
Chemistry
Environmental Studies
Computer Science/Informatics Practices
Economics/Business Economics
Fine Arts/Visual Arts (Sculpture/Painting)/Commercial Art
Geography/Geology
History
Home Science
Knowledge Tradition Practices in India
Mass Media/Mass Communication
Mathematics / Applied Mathematics
Performing Arts
Physical Education/National Cadet Corps (NCC)/Yoga
Physics
Political Science
Psychology
Sanskrit
Sociology
3. General Aptitude Test:
This test is designed for Vocational, Open Eligibility, Cross Stream, and other applicable categories. It primarily assesses:
Logical Reasoning
Analytical Skills
Quantitative Aptitude
General Awareness
Jawaharlal Nehru University (JNU) offers admission to 25 undergraduate (UG) programs through the Common University Entrance Test (CUET) 2025. To secure admission, candidates must select the appropriate subjects as per the CUET subject mapping criteria. Below is the list of all courses offered by JNU along with their corresponding CUET UG 2025 subject mapping criteria:
Jawaharlal Nehru University offers B.A. (Hons) programs in various languages under the CUET UG 2025 framework. Students seeking admission to these programs must appear for the English and General Aptitude Test as part of the CUET. The table below provides the detailed subject mapping for each B.A. (Hons) program.
Jawaharlal Nehru University CUET UG Subject Mapping 2025 | |
Programme/Course Offered |
CUET Subject Mapping |
B.A. (Hons) Persian |
English, General Aptitude Test |
B.A. (Hons) Pashto |
English, General Aptitude Test |
B.A. (Hons) Arabic |
English, General Aptitude Test |
B.A. (Hons) Japanese |
English, General Aptitude Test |
B.A. (Hons) Korean |
English, General Aptitude Test |
B.A. (Hons) Chinese |
English, General Aptitude Test |
B.A. (Hons) French |
English, General Aptitude Test |
B.A. (Hons) German |
English, General Aptitude Test |
B.A. (Hons) Russian |
English, General Aptitude Test |
B.A. (Hons) Spanish |
English, General Aptitude Test |
Jawaharlal Nehru University offers a B.Sc. Programme in Ayurveda Biology through the CUET UG 2025. Admission to this program requires candidates to appear for multiple subjects, including Sanskrit, Physics, Chemistry, and a choice between Biology or Mathematics, along with the General Aptitude Test. The detailed subject mapping is provided in the table below.
Jawaharlal Nehru University CUET UG Subject Mapping For Bachelor of Science (B.Sc.) Program | |
Programme/Course Offered |
CUET Subject Mapping |
B.Sc. Programme in Ayurveda Biology |
Sanskrit (Paper Code 325), Physics (Paper Code 322), Chemistry (Paper Code 306) - All Three Required General Aptitude Test (Paper Code 501) Biology (Paper Code 304) or Mathematics (Paper Code 319) - Any One |
Jawaharlal Nehru University offers various Certificate of Proficiency (COP) programs aimed at providing foundational knowledge in specific languages, philosophies, and wellness studies. Admission to these programs is based on English and the General Aptitude Test through CUET UG 2025. The detailed subject mapping for each COP program is provided in the table below.
Jawaharlal Nehru University CUET UG Subject Mapping For Certificate of Proficiency (COP) Programs | |
Programme/Course Offered |
CUET Subject Mapping |
COP in Mongolian |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Bhasha Indonesia |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Urdu |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Pashto |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Uzbek |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Hebrew |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Pali |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Sanskrit Computational Linguistics |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Yoga Philosophy |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Vedic Culture |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Sanskrit |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Natya Shastra |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Health Awareness and Wellness |
English, General Aptitude Test |
COP in Indian Philosophy |
English, General Aptitude Test |
